Wichita State University is located in Wichita, KS.

During the most recent reporting year, 18 physical education & coaching degrees were awarded at Wichita State University.

Online & Distance Learning at Wichita State University

Online coursework is an option at Wichita State University. Among 16,689 students, 4,761 (29%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 5,354 (32%) took at least some classes online.

Student Demographics & Diversity

The following sections describe the diversity of Physical Education & Coaching graduates at Wichita State University, broken down by degree level.

Looking at the program as a whole, Physical Education & Coaching graduates at Wichita State University are 89% women (16) and 11% men (2).

Physical Education & Coaching Bachelor’s Program at Wichita State University

Of the 10 bachelor’s physical education & coaching graduates at Wichita State University, 80% were women (8) and 20% were men (2).

Wichita State University gender breakdown of Physical Education & Coaching Bachelor's degree recipients

The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Physical Education & Coaching bachelor’s degree recipients at Wichita State University.

Race / Ethnicity Number of Graduates
White 7
Hispanic / Latino 1
Two or More Races 1
Unknown 1
Racial-ethnic diversity of Physical Education & Coaching majors at Wichita State University

Minority students account for 20% of Physical Education & Coaching bachelor’s degree recipients at Wichita State University, below the national average of 31%.*

*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
